    ‘backdated payments are made under what is known as the LEAP review, which began in June 2018 and involves the DWP looking through the cases of approximately 1.6 million PIP claimants after it lost two landmark legal cases and had to amend its assessment guidance to decision makers.’ Daily record May 2021

    this process was apparently paused in March 2020.

    Presumably paused due to Covid-19, the upsurge of UC claimants, & also those claiming PIP for the first time (as recent figures show). Please see: https://www.gov.uk/government/statistics/personal-independence-payment-statistics-to-april-2021/personal-independence-payment-statistics-to-april-2021    which states,

    'Latest quarterly figures to April 2021 show:

    170,000 registrations for new claims, the highest quarterly level of new claim registrations since PIP began
    26,000 reported changes of circumstance, also the highest quarterly level of change of circumstance activity since PIP began'
